    Steam games freeze on launch in Windows 8

    When I click on any game to launch in Windows 8 inside steam the entire thing freezes. It does not move a ahead. The game does not start nor there is any error report on the screen. I have to restart my pc to turn those things that are working in the background. I need some help to fix this. If I re-install the entire steam then I think will lost all my achievements. So I cannot do that without testing it out. Is there a way to fix the issue. I had tried looking on the web for solution and most of them are asking for the re-installation thing. But there it is not going to work. I do not even have the game setup file with me.

    Re: Steam games freeze on launch in Windows 8

    You have to anyhow re-install the game to get a proper output. Or else your the game client will not work well. There is a simple way of doing the same. You have to go in the steam folder and from there you have to backup a few things. You can start with /cfg/. This one has all custom configurations and scripts. You can also backup the downloads and maps folder with materials. The last thing you have to backup is the SAVE folder. After when you are done with the same you can simply go ahead and re-install steam. You have to restore the data of the folders back again and done. The stream issue will be resolved.
